Action item from the Korvath training stall: we had no visibility into GPU memory fragmentation, so the OOM looked like a data bug. You'll own the profiling harness. Wire the memtrace hook into the Skylon trainer, snapshot allocator stats at fixed step intervals, and push summaries to the dashboard. Keep overhead under two percent. Defaults should match what we validated in staging; the sampling constants are listed below.

tuning table, yajog-yahof:
BUDGETS = {
    "lamvan": 303,
    "wenox": 460,
    "fenvan": 525,
}

## Deployment — Userhive Extraction

The user module was split out of the Granfall monolith into its own service, Userhive. Deploys go through the standard Bellows pipeline; the monolith proxies auth calls to Userhive during the transition. Deploy the monolith first, then Userhive, never the reverse. Userhive boots with the following configuration values.

settings of tajep-tafog:
CASDOR_LOG_LEVEL=info
CASDOR_METRICS_HOST=metrics.casdor.nelvrosys.internal
CASDOR_POOL_SIZE=16

Handover — front desk, Thornfield House. Contractors from Merrivale Fitouts arrive Tuesday and Thursday this week. Check photo ID, log them in the blue binder, issue a lanyard from the drawer. They are NOT to go past the second-floor lobby unescorted — ring Priya on facilities if no escort shows within ten minutes. Lanyards back by 17:00, no exceptions. If the turnstile rejects a lanyard, let them through the side gate using the following code.

staff pass of kawep-hahap = bdg-IEUUF-6

- [ ] Step 7: Archive cold storage buckets (Glacierline tier). Confirm both ceremony witnesses are present, verify bucket manifests match the Oxbow ledger, then seal the archive key shares. Plugin authors may observe but not handle shares. Once sealed, the archive index itself is encrypted and can only be reopened with the passphrase below.

vault phrase of badup-hahig = tamael-aldael-kelmir-istael-fenok-istwyn-tamius-jorath-oliion